Finding the Best Attorney: Your Comprehensive Guide
Securing the skilled attorney is vital when facing a legal matter. Start your search by identifying your specific needs; do you require help with some contract case, a criminal charge, or another type of completely different? Next, think about multiple options, leveraging resources like online directories, suggestions from family, and state bar associations. Always carefully check potential attorneys' records, examine their internet reviews, and set up preliminary consultations to evaluate their knowledge and personality. In conclusion, selecting the correct attorney is an major decision that will have a impact.

Finding the Appropriate Attorney regarding Your Matter
Deciding a skilled attorney is a challenging undertaking. First, investigate potential lawyers through referrals. Give careful consideration to their practice area; you need someone who is familiar with the particular legal field involved in your case. Furthermore, arrange consultations with a few potential attorneys to talk about your case and judge their approach and fees. In conclusion, choose the attorney with you trust most comfortable and that demonstrates a promise to securing a favorable outcome on your behalf.
